    Checking the work of the DNS client service

    When an error jumped out that the DNS server does not respond, do not hurry to change the Internet settings and check whether the service functions in principle. To do this, just press Win + R on the keyboard and drive the command. services.msc.Manager, as easy to guess, all system services. There, find the management service upon request "DNS client" and go to its properties on the right click of the mouse. Enable automatic launch, then run the service if it has not been active before it. If the service was turned off, then, after a simple reboot of your PC, everything will fall into place, and you get rid of the problem on the root.

    Clearing DNS Cache and Reset Network Settings

    If you made any changes in the settings, and initially everything worked well - you need to reset the network settings, and to do this, open the command line. Just enter the CMD command in the search by applications, click on the file found right-click and open it on the name of the administrator. In the window that appears, you will need to enter the following commands (after each command, it is necessary to make ENTER for execution). After executing all the commands, you must restart the computer.

    1. ipconfig / Flushdns.
    2. ipconfig / registerdns
    3. ipconfig / renew.
    4. ipconfig / Release

    So we correct all the settings of the DNS that you changed, and solve the problem if the device or resource DNS does not respond.

    Checking Hosts File

    Malicious software can harm the computer by changing the parameters of the HOSTS file. To eliminate malfunction you need to go along the way C: \\ Windows \\ System32 \\ DRIVERS \\ ETC Open HOSTS file by any text editor on behalf of the administrator (the most convenient to use "Notepad") and delete all postswho do not start with the lattice, except 127.0.0.1 localhost. After that, to save changes and check whether the problem disappeared.

    Check the DNS connection settings

    You can see the settings of the DNS server in the properties of available networks. To avoid errors, you can assign automatic receiving DNS addresses, as well as use Google service servers. In most cases, this method eradicates problems. Follow the following algorithm:

    1. Right click on the icon of available connections located on the desktop system panel.
    2. Open the General Access Management Center tab. And go to the adapter settings section.
    3. In the list of available connections, select the active, which is currently running, go to the properties. Wi-Fi is indicated as a wireless network, and the cable connection is Ethernet. In the menu that appears, click TCP / IPv4 and go to properties.
    4. If the DNS address number number is specified, then activate the automatic receipt of addresses by putting a tick in the appropriate place.
    5. Save and restart the system.

    Very often, in such situations, it helps to fill the digital fields from Google servers. Enter: 8: 8: 8: 8, 8: 8: 4; 4. If such an error is relevant for all devices connected to a wireless communication, you can solve it in the router settings (WAN section) by filling out the same addresses.
